[0001] This utility model relates to the field of polyethylene filler masterbatch production technology, specifically a high-speed mixer for polyethylene filler masterbatch with a circulating water cooling system. Background Technology
[0002] Polyethylene filler masterbatch is a functional plastic additive, mainly composed of polyethylene resin and inorganic fillers. It is processed into high-concentration masterbatch for use in the production of plastic products. Its core function is to reduce the cost of plastics while improving the physical properties of materials. In the production process of polyethylene filler masterbatch, the high-speed mixer is a key pretreatment equipment. It is mainly used to efficiently mix, preheat and initially disperse raw materials such as polyethylene resin, inorganic fillers, coupling agents and lubricants, so as to provide a uniform premix for subsequent melt extrusion granulation.
[0003] In existing technologies, when high-speed mixers pre-treat raw materials, the high-speed stirring paddles generate a large amount of heat due to friction and shearing during mixing, which may lead to local overheating of the materials, causing softening of polyethylene or decomposition of additives, affecting product quality. Currently, intermittent air cooling is mostly used for cooling, with external fans for forced heat dissipation. However, the cooling efficiency is low and is greatly affected by ambient temperature, making it difficult to meet the needs of continuous production. Therefore, a high-speed mixer for polyethylene filler masterbatch with a circulating water cooling system is proposed to solve the above-mentioned technical problem of low cooling efficiency. [0024] The circulating water cooling assembly 200 includes a water cooling jacket 21 and a plate heat exchanger 22. The cross-sectional shape of the water cooling jacket 21 is circular, and the water cooling jacket 21 is disposed on the outside of the mixer body 100. The plate heat exchanger 22 is disposed on the mixer body 100. A circulation component is disposed on the mixer body 100, and the circulation component is used to circulate the cooling water in the water cooling jacket 21.
[0025] It should be noted that the water-cooling jacket 21 adopts a ring-shaped design, which tightly wraps the outer wall of the mixer body 100 to form a uniform cooling cavity. The cooling water in the water-cooling jacket 21 exchanges heat with the mixer body 100 to achieve cooling.
[0026] Furthermore, the circulation component includes a first circulation pipe 201 disposed on the water-cooling jacket 21, a circulation module 202 disposed on the first circulation pipe 201 along the cooling water flow direction, a second circulation pipe 203 connected to the output end of the circulation module 202, and a third circulation pipe 204 connected to the water-cooling jacket 21.
[0027] A support plate is provided on the water-cooling jacket 21, and the circulation module 202 is mounted on the support plate. The support plate provides support for the circulation module 202.
[0028] The end of the first circulation pipe 201 away from the water-cooled jacket 21 is connected to the input end of the circulation module 202; the end of the second circulation pipe 203 away from the circulation module 202 is connected to the liquid inlet end of the plate heat exchanger 22; and the end of the third circulation pipe 204 away from the water-cooled jacket 21 is connected to the liquid outlet end of the plate heat exchanger 22.
[0029] It should be noted that the plate heat exchanger 22 is a common device in the prior art. The plate heat exchanger 22 adopts a multi-layer corrugated plate stacking design to form alternating hot flow channels and cold flow channels. The special structure of the corrugated plates generates strong turbulence to cool the high-temperature cooling water. The high-temperature cooling water enters the plate heat exchanger 22 from the second circulation pipe 203, and the cooled water returns to the water-cooled jacket 21 through the third circulation pipe 204.
[0030] Please see Figure 3-4 In this embodiment, a plurality of heat-conducting needles 211 are arranged on the water-cooling jacket 21 along the vertical direction. The heat-conducting needles 211 are arranged on the water-cooling jacket 21 and their two ends respectively penetrate and extend into the water-cooling jacket 21 and the interior of the mixing body 100.
[0031] The heat-conducting needle 211 is made of any one of copper, aluminum alloy, tungsten alloy, or zinc alloy. Copper, aluminum alloy, tungsten alloy, and zinc alloy have good thermal conductivity and can quickly conduct the heat generated by the material in the mixing body 100 to the water-cooling jacket 21, reducing the risk of local overheating and ensuring temperature uniformity.
[0032] The inner wall of the water-cooled jacket 21 is provided with a plurality of first flow-slowing rings 212 and a plurality of second flow-slowing rings 213, and the plurality of first flow-slowing rings 212 and second flow-slowing rings 213 are distributed in an alternating manner.
[0033] It is known that the staggered first slow-flow ring 212 and second slow-flow ring 213 optimize the flow path of the cooling water in the water-cooled jacket 21, extend the residence time of the cooling water, and improve the heat exchange efficiency.
[0034] It should be noted that the control unit controls the start and stop of the circulation module 202 and the flow rate of the cooling water, so that the cooling water flows at a constant speed in the circulating water cooling component 200, thereby achieving uniform cooling of the mixing body 100; the control unit and its working principle are well known to those skilled in the art, and will not be described in this embodiment.
[0035] The working principle of the above embodiments is as follows:
[0036] When using the mixer 100 to pretreat polyethylene filler masterbatch raw materials, a large amount of heat is generated due to friction and shearing, causing localized overheating of the material, leading to softening of polyethylene or decomposition of additives, affecting product quality. At this time, cooling water flows through the water-cooled jacket 21, absorbing the heat generated by the mixer 100 as it passes through the chamber of the water-cooled jacket 21. After heat exchange, the cooling water leaves the water-cooled jacket 21 through the first circulation pipe 201 and is transported by the circulation module 202 through the second circulation pipe 203 to the plate heat exchanger 22. High-temperature cooling water flows from the second circulation pipe 203... 3. The cooling water enters the plate heat exchanger 22 and is cooled by the plate heat exchanger 22. It then returns to the water-cooled jacket 21 through the third circulation pipe 204, thus achieving the purpose of water-cooled circulation. At the same time, several heat conduction needles 211 can quickly conduct the heat generated by the material in the mixer body 100 to the water-cooled jacket 21, reducing the risk of local overheating and ensuring temperature uniformity. The staggered first slow flow ring 212 and second slow flow ring 213 optimize the water flow path of the cooling water in the water-cooled jacket 21, extend the residence time of the cooling water, improve the heat exchange efficiency, and meet the needs of high-load continuous production.
